UCI Completes Final Round of Bill Cullum Invitational

February 03, 2026

SOMIS, Calif. – The UC Irvine men's golf team wrapped up action at the spring season-opening Bill Cullum Invitational Tuesday at The Saticoy Club.
 
The Anteaters finished 12th with a 54-hole score of 935 (310-311-314).
 
Cal State Fullerton combined for an 889 (295-303-291) to edge Cal Poly by one stroke for the team title. Individually, the Mustangs' Rafael Bobo-Lloret and Utah State's David Liechty tied for first at even-par 216.
 
Senior Rei Harashima led the 'Eaters with a three-round total of 229 (79-75-75). He had a team-best five birdies on the day and climbed nine spots in the standings into a tie for 27th.
 
Junior Jason Tang was UCI's next finisher as he tied for 31st with a 231 (77-76-78). Sophomore Jack Yu also tied for 44th (233), while freshman Kody Li tied for 65th (242). Sophomore Owen Davis-Piger rounded out the lineup in 73rd (247).
 
UC Irvine will be idle for the next two weeks before returning to action at the Wyoming Desert Intercollegiate in Palm Desert, California, Feb. 23-25.
